> > Rx descriptor is 16B/32B in size and consists of multiple words.
> > The word that includes DD field should be read first. Read result with
> > DD bit set indicates the rest part in a descriptor is valid.
> Suggest rewording as follows:
> Rx descriptor is 16B/32B in size. If the DD bit is set, it indicates that the rest of
> the descriptor words have valid values. Hence, the word containing DD bit
> must be read first before reading the rest of the descriptor words.
> 
> >
> > In NEON vector PMD, vector load loads two contiguous 8B of descriptor
> > data into vector register. Given vector load ensures no 16B atomicity,
> > read of the word that includes DD field could be reordered after read
> > of other words. In this case, some words could be invalid data.
> "some words could contain invalid data"
> 
> >
> > Read barrier is added after read of qword1 that includes DD field.
> > And qword0 is reloaded to update vector register. This ensures what
> > fetched is correct descriptor data.
> "This ensures that the fetched data is correct".
